Abstract

<PICT:0878884/III/1> <PICT:0878884/III/2> <PICT:0878884/III/3> In the porcelain enamelling of a metal article, the article is supported with the surface to be enamelled generally vertical, a flat stream of slurry consisting of a suspension of frit in water is applied to the upper edge of the surface in a quantity sufficient to flow across the surface whereby an alluvial coating of damp frit is deposited thereon and the frit is then fused on the surface into an imperforate layer of porcelain. The sheets 2, which may be of corrugated steel are carried on an oblong or elongated oval conveyer 1 between pipes 3, by which they are covered by the slurry, thence through a drying oven to a fusing furnace. The slurry in a tank 9, open upwardly, is forced through a conduit 8 by a pump 6 operated from a motor 7 and through a manifold 5 to the pipes 3 which are vertically disposed with closed tops and with vertical slits 4 adjacent the tops, the pipes 3 being telescopic so that the slits are positioned opposite the upper edges of the sheets 2 to give a flat stream which flows downwardly over the sheets 2, any excess slurry falling back into the tank 9 for recirculation. The coating apparatus is mounted on a framework 10 on castors 11 for exact positioning relative to the path of the sheets 2. The conveyer 1 comprises a track 12 under which each carriage 13 is slung by a pair of rods 14 with rollers 15 running on the track 12 and hooks 16 to engage in openings 17 in a hanger bar 18. A yoke 19, pivotally supported at the centre of bar 18, has lateral arms 191 for supporting beams 20 each of which has a pair of pivoted wires 21 with hooked ends for engagement with holes 22 in the upper margins of the sheets 2. Each yoke 19 may also have legs 1911 for carrying other shaped articles. The carriages 13 are coupled by links 25, 26 with an endless chain, a pair of sheets 2 being carried by two linked carriages 13 which are spaced from the next pair a sufficient distance to avoid overlap of the sheets 2 while rounding a curve in the track 12. As the sheets 2 pass the end of the tank 9, wipers 27 engage lightly the lower edge to remove any droplets.
